Bathing in a 0.5% apple cider vinegar solution isn't a useful treatment for atopic dermatitis, and it can be irritating to the skin, report researchers in a recent study.Is vinegar good for eczema itch?
Healthy skin is protected by an acidic barrier. If you have eczema, your skin pH levels are elevated, and this barrier doesn't function properly. Without it, moisture escapes and irritants are allowed in. Apple cider vinegar is acidic, so applying it to the skin may help restore your skin's natural pH balance.What is the fastest natural cure for eczema?

How do you use apple cider vinegar for eczema?
ACV wet wrapMix a solution with 1 cup warm water and 1 tablespoon of ACV. Apply the solution to gauze or strips clean cotton fabric and apply it to the skin. Cover the dressing in dry, clean, cotton fabric. Wear your wet wrap for 3 hours or overnight.

What clears up eczema?
Corticosteroid creams, solutions, gels, foams, and ointments. These treatments, made with hydrocortisone steroids, can quickly relieve itching and reduce inflammation. They come in different strengths, from mild over-the-counter (OTC) treatments to stronger prescription medicines.How do I get rid of eczema permanently?
Eczema is a chronic condition, which means that it cannot be cured. Treatments, however, are very effective in reducing the symptoms of itchy, dry skin.What is the root cause of eczema?
The exact cause of eczema is unknown. It is caused due to an overactive immune system that responds aggressively when exposed to triggers. Eczema. Baking soda is not a cure for eczema, but it may help relieve the itch associated with it. The National Eczema Association recommends adding 1/4 cup baking soda to a warm (not hot) bath and soaking for 10 to 15 minutes. Gently towel dry your skin and moisturize afterwards.Does vinegar dry out skin?

How do you stop eczema from spreading?
For a severe outbreak, apply steroid cream and then wrap a wet bandage around the area to keep it moist. Light therapy from the sun or with a UV ray device at your doctor's office may ease outbreaks, too. For strong eczema itching that keeps you up at night, try oral antihistamines.Does urine help clear eczema?
